In the early 20th century, Serbia stood at a crossroads, grappling with its national identity amidst political turmoil and cultural renaissance. In "Serbia: A Sketch," author Helen Leah Reed delves into the rich tapestry of Serbian history, highlighting the country’s resilience and the profound impact of its quest for autonomy. This insightful work examines the interplay of tradition and modernity, emphasizing the importance of cultural heritage and national pride. Ideal for historians and civic activists, Reed's narrative offers a compelling exploration of Serbia's struggles and aspirations, making it an essential read for anyone interested in the complexities of national identity and the enduring spirit of a people striving for recognition and freedom.
